Tandem of Peace on Wednesday 14th June 2006

Fifth day

The members of the group of the Tandem of Peace at the base of the UNHCR - High Commissariat of the Political Refugees

Geneva - "There on the mountains..." We are in the village of Heidi! Arèches is a wonderful alpine small country, where the smell of the cows and the hay wake you up in the morning and mix to the taste of the  local cheeses. We stay at a holiday house of Orly: a very folk complex of mountain chalets. After breakfast, we equip ourselves to leave, but the bad luck falls on us: one of the group feels ill and a lost mobile phone lets us lose important minutes. However we can leave quite soon with the vans to go down under Arèches, in Albertville, from where we leave by bicycles. Since one of ours today doesn't pedal Ettore has a great advantage: he can use another better bicycle, pending of repairing his own. From Albertville to Annecy, along a huge and magnificent lake, a very long cycle path that has let us do half way in safety stretches. At Annecy we have stopped for a break. It has been a heavy mistake: the crystalline waters of the lake were very convincing to let us leave the bicycles and the path to Geneva. Unwillingly, with the purpose of coming back there, we have left the banks of the lake and we have gone again along our way. The view has changed very fast: high hills have taken place of the wide plain. But with the strenght of the legs, and especially with that one of the will, we could get over the obstacles and reach Geneva. At the gates of the town we have called our deputy head, the Teacher Elisabetta Vani, to give her information about us. After her congratulations and reassurances we have come into Geneva. To arrive at the High Commissariat of the Political Refugees of the United Nations (UNHCR) it has been more difficult than expected, but thanks to the indications of the inhabitants we arrived at the expected place in time. We needed half an hour to get ready after the great effort, we entered the Commissariat ONU. Here we have been received enthusiastically by Annalura Sacco, person in charge and coordinator of the Commissariat of Geneva, who has explained us the function of the UNHCR and her role within it. Then she has answered our questions about the condition of the political refugees in Italy and has showed us a video that illustrates the work of the UNCHR during the last year. After having thanked, we have gone again by minibus along the way of Arèches, having the only aim to go back to the lake and a rest.
